A useful treatment for privet is a water-based solution of glyphosate and triclopyr at a 2:1 ratio, respectively, as glyphosate alone is an ineffective foliar treatment for this species. I suggest pruning the top each time you do a renovation, even if you don’t want to reduce the overall height. Although it can be nerve-wracking to make big cuts, be assured there are hundreds of dormant buds waiting just below the surface of each trunk and branch that will sprout once the sun shines upon them. When woody plants are repeatedly sheared, a dense layer of tiny twigs builds up on the outside, shading the interior stems and inhibiting dormant buds from sprouting.
